Dubai Taxi Corporation Integrates Tesla Electric Vehicles
Introduction to Dubai's Taxi System
Over the years, Dubai has built a vast infrastructure of its taxis that operate 24/7, covering every nook and corner of the fast-paced city. With a plethora of options ranging from standard to premium categories, every move made by the Dubai Taxi Corporation is heavily influenced by the country’s vision of sustainable development. Expansion of Tesla in Dubai's Taxi Fleet
Following the successful completion of the pilot program, Dubai’s Roads and Transport Authority (RTA) has decided to incorporate additional Tesla Model 3 cars to further test their feasibility before making a permanent shift to electric taxis.
RTA's Vision for Sustainable Development
Mattar Al Tayer, Director-General and Chairman of the Board of Executive Directors, commented, “The usage of Tesla electric vehicles in the Dubai taxi fleet is an exceptional experience. This initiative contributes to realizing His Highness Sheikh Mohammed bin Rashid Al Maktoum’s Green Economy for Sustainable Development Initiative and supports Dubai Government’s energy and low carbon strategy aimed at making Dubai a model for efficient energy use and reduced carbon emissions.”
Benefits of Electric Mobility
The RTA also noted that the positive feedback received from these vehicles expands the scope for utilizing electric mobility in the future, affirming their commitment to lowering carbon emissions and preventing adverse environmental effects. This initiative is a significant step towards transitioning 90% of the Dubai Taxi Corporation's fleet into hybrid (petrol+battery) and fully electric vehicles.
Performance of Tesla Model 3 in Dubai
The reliability of the new Tesla Model 3 cars has been strongly embraced by the associates of the Dubai Taxi Corporation, allowing these vehicles to operate continuously, all seven days a week. Tesla cars are currently catering to all-day and night services, covering high-density areas and Dubai airports.
Tesla models also serve as premium taxis in the city and offer the availability of semi-autonomous driving features.
Future of Electric Vehicles in Dubai
Al Tayer remarked, “The success of that experiment prompts us to widen the scope of using electric vehicles as part of the Dubai Taxi fleet over the upcoming years. This initiative is the first of its kind worldwide in adopting a semi-total transformation of limousines into environmentally-friendly vehicles.”

Performance Specifications
The Model 3 is powered by a dual 82 kWh battery, with one battery paired with each axle, generating a combined output of 513 hp and 660 Nm of torque for the performance version. It achieves a top speed of 261 Km/h and accelerates from 0 to 100 Km/h in an impressive 3.3 seconds. On a single charge, it can travel up to 547 km.
